Human dexterity with robotic precision
The design of the cyber-arm mimics human anatomy (flexible "joints", rotating wrists), and the AI ​​learns by observing people.

The hands cope with delicate tasks that require pinpoint precision: from preparing gourmet dishes to sorting fragile materials.

Thanks to pressure sensors, computer vision and replaceable modules, our robotic arms combine the power of industrial machines with the dexterity of an experienced craftsman.

Key Features
Human-like sensitivity:
  • Pressure sensors: adjust gripping force in real time, from gently holding a berry to confidently handling a soldering iron
  • Haptic feedback: sensors recognize texture, temperature, and fragility of objects, preventing damage

AI-powered computer vision:
  • Object recognition: distinguishes a raw egg from a lemon, and a fragile vase from a box
  • Adaptive learning: improves task performance by analyzing operator actions and reducing errors

Interchangeable modules:
  • Tools for the task: Interchangeable grippers, blades, suction cups, and spatulas allow you to quickly switch between roles: from chef to logistician
  • Plug-and-Play: Change modules in seconds - turn the robot into a bartender, sorter, or artist

Highest precision:
  • Micron-level accuracy: Ideal for assembling microchips, decorating desserts, or working with jewelry
  • Vibration-free system: Provides stability even at high speed, which is critical for glass, pharmaceuticals or electronics
Development

Inspired by the biomechanics of the human hand, our cybernetic limbs are equipped with high-sensitivity sensors, machine vision systems, and AI algorithms that enable microsurgery-level operations, electronic assembly, or handling of fragile materials.


From labs to conveyors, robotic arms perform tasks that were previously only possible for humans: gripping complex-shaped objects, multi-axis soldering, and micron-precision coating. They are easily integrated into existing lines, learn in real time, and operate 24/7, eliminating defects, injuries, and downtime.


  • Premium dexterity: 360° rotation, adjustable gripping force, response to environmental changes.
  • AI platform: self-learning algorithms for non-standard scenarios, from sorting to customized packaging.
  • Compact and powerful: human-sized hands enable installation even in confined spaces
  • Versatility: suitable for pharmaceuticals, microelectronics, food industry and other sectors with strict standards.

Our next goal
We plan to develop affordable bionic prostheses. Those that will not just replace lost functions, but will become a step towards a new quality of life.
Using the experience of creating robots, we want to transfer artificial intelligence and biosensor technologies to medicine to provide natural mobility, tactile sensitivity and full control over artificial limbs.

  • Neurointegration: direct interaction with the nervous system for intuitive control.
  • Adaptability: algorithms will learn your habits, adjusting to your gait, grip or movement dynamics.
  • Biocompatibility: lightweight, durable materials and ergonomic design for 24/7 comfort.
  • Versatility: solutions for rehabilitation after injuries, congenital anomalies or age-related changes.
